The Redwoods is in Windsor and in Windsor And Maidenhead district. SL4 3TA is located in the Old Windsor elect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Windsor. This postcode has been in use since 1994-12-01.

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ding SL4 3TA,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.5%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of SL4 3TA there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 62.5%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(93.5%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is The Redwoods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around The Redwoods was 29.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 63.4% lower than the Clewer & Dedworth East average. The most reported crime type was Burglary.

The Redwoods has the 25th lowest crime rate of 89 local areas in Clewer & Dedworth East and the 140th lowest crime rate of 448 local areas in Windsor and Maidenhead .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 6.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-37.5%.

Employment

SL4 3TA area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 16%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 13%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

SL4 3TA area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
